Undated (1900). LE NID. By Jean-Baptiste Daniel-Dupuis. AE plaquette 37mm x 66mm. Obv: A nude female looking at two fledglings in a nest. Rev: A putto, seated on a branch, feeding a small bird. Cat. Gen. vol # 175/D. Maier 121.

Jean-Baptiste Daniel Dupuis, French painter, sculptor and medallist, was born in 1849. At the age of seventeen he entered l??cole Nationale Sup?rieur des Beaux-Arts. In 1868 he won second Prix de Rome for medal engraving and the first Grand Prix de Rome in 1872. He exhibited regularly at the Salon. He was made an officer of the L?gion d?Honneur in 1898. Dupuis died tragically in 1899. He was shot in his sleep by his wife, who had a history of mental illness. His wife then turned the gun on herself and committed suicide.? Daniel-Dupuis created an extensive body of medallic works.
